I run the program, open the form, the date is populated, everything is just peachy. Then I exit the program and try to open the form to make some changes. I get an error because when the form is opened, it calls the function and the function uses a constant that is not defined at design time. If I just open VFP and open the form, this does not happen. It only happens after I run the program, exit it, and then try to open the form in the IDE. The app seems to be exiting properly - never had a problem with dangling references or anything like that - but I suppose it could be something like that.
